Output 7bf0148e7a2e41540e81f4d8bce64c02a7f56c377f9a5ad162ecbac57c04bf9d:0

value
628
script pubkey
OP_0 OP_PUSHBYTES_20 8b8f51041bcefacaaee1e2b0e9b2c6fcea489d51
address
bc1q3w84zpqmemav4thpu2cwnvkxln4y3823qqsn7r
transaction
7bf0148e7a2e41540e81f4d8bce64c02a7f56c377f9a5ad162ecbac57c04bf9d
confirmations
67919
spent
true